From Urine to Stem Cells: A New Project to Study Prader-Willi Syndrome and Its Liver Complications

The Fondazione Italiana Fegato will develop a personalized, non-invasive cellular model to investigate the mechanisms underlying the disease

Generating pluripotent stem cells from a simple urine sample to study a rare genetic disease and its liver complications in the laboratory: this is the aim of a research project by the Fondazione Italiana Fegato ETS in Trieste focusing on Prader-Willi syndrome.

The project, entitled *“Generation of induced pluripotent stem cells from urine samples: a pilot study in patients with Prader-Willi syndrome”*, is made possible thanks to a contribution from the Fondazioni Benefiche Alberto e Kathleen Casali ETS. It is the result of a collaboration between the Fondazione Italiana Fegato, the IRCCS Istituto Auxologico Italiano, the University of Trieste, and the Philippines’ Department of Science and Technology, known as DOST.

Prader-Willi syndrome is a rare genetic disorder characterized by uncontrollable appetite, severe obesity, and metabolic abnormalities, with an increased risk of developing hepatic steatosis. To investigate the mechanisms underlying the disease, researchers will use an innovative, non-invasive approach: cells present in urine samples will be isolated and reprogrammed into induced pluripotent stem cells, known as hiPSCs. These cells can differentiate into different cell types, making it possible to reproduce specific features of the disease in the laboratory. Samples will be collected at the IRCCS Istituto Auxologico Italiano – San Giuseppe Hospital in Piancavallo and subsequently analyzed in the laboratories of the Fondazione Italiana Fegato in Trieste.

“Being able to obtain stem cells from a sample collected without the need for invasive procedures represents an important advantage, particularly in the study of rare diseases,” explains Cristina Bellarosa, Senior Scientist and Group Leader of the Innovative Models Unit at the Fondazione Italiana Fegato. “These cells could serve as a personalized model to investigate the mechanisms underlying the syndrome and explore new potential therapeutic strategies. The protocol developed as part of this project could also be applied in the future to other rare genetic diseases, contributing to the development of new models for personalized medicine.”

The project specifically involves a Filipino PhD student at the University of Trieste, as part of an agreement between DOST, the Fondazione Italiana Fegato, and the University of Trieste. The young researcher will work alongside a master’s degree student from the same university, within a framework of international scientific training and collaboration.
